  • Patent number: 10868864
    Abstract: A fault-tolerant Remote Direct Memory Access (RDMA) system and method enables RDMA operations for a given queue pair to be initiated over first and second network fabrics associated with first and second physical R_Keys. The fault-tolerant RDMA system/method supports host channel adapter hardware having only one port while maintaining network fabric fault tolerance by virtualizing the R_Key associated with the first and second network fabrics.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: April 16, 2018
    Date of Patent: December 15, 2020
    Assignee: Hewlett Packard Enterprise Development LP
    Inventor: James R Hamrick, Jr.

  • Patent number: 7509657
    Abstract: An electronic system may include an application programming interface for use in conjunction with a virtual switch. In some embodiments, the electronic system may comprise a processor; a network interface controller including a hardware port, a virtual switch comprising software executed by the processor, and an application programming interface (“API”) running on the processor and usable by a application to interface with the virtual switch.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: October 28, 2003
    Date of Patent: March 24, 2009
    Assignee: Hewlett-Packard Development Company, L.P.
    Inventors: Pankaj Mehra, Rahul Nim, James R. Hamrick
  • Publication number: 20040139236
    Abstract: An electronic system comprises a processor, network interface controller (“NIC”) and a virtual switch. The virtual switch may comprise software executed by the processor and may include a plurality of virtual ports. The virtual ports may provide communications with an application running on the processor and the network interface controller.
    Type: Application
    Filed: January 9, 2003
    Publication date: July 15, 2004
    Inventors: Pankaj Mehra, Rahul Nim, James R. Hamrick
